Our Mission Statement

The United Court of the Lone Star Empire, Inc. is a non-profit membership organization which exists to provide service and support for the local Community. We live out our mission through:

 

From the HEART – We hear the call of a Community in need. Our empathy and passion about raising funds for HIV/AIDS agencies, community healthcare needs, hunger/nutritional support, GLBTQ youth organizations, and other vulnerable members of society is the cry of our hearts.

 

Through the COURT – Through rich traditions of years gone by we come together to perform service projects that provide direct relief of others distress. We support local non-profit agencies by raising much needed funds so that they can carry out their mission to provide professional and direct relief to the community.

Founded and operated as a sovereign and independent organization we align ourselves with the International Court System’s ideas of service and charity. We also pay homage to and live out the rich traditions of regal, royalty and charity, which we call “The Game.” We practice the tenets of pomp and circumstance, decorum, joviality, regal and the honorable while not taking ourselves too seriously. Our game, titles and adornments is “camp in nature” – meaning for show. The service we provide and the funds we raise – our purpose – is serious as the needs of our suffering Community.

 

For the COMMUNITY – We are active members of our Community. Through the works of our presence and goodwill, we actively engage in relationships throughout our Geographical Service Area. As participants in our Community, we can more readily know its needs and can therefore provide the necessary support. As an organization rooted in the GLBTQ community we form relationships that build and lift up our mission. Our focus is the Community, and at the end of the day our energy, time and efforts are to ease the distress of our Community. We are of the Community and for the Community.

Our Philosophy

The primary purpose of the UCLSE shall be to raise funds in order to assist other IRS 501(c)(3) organizations who provide direct relief to the local community . The fundraising efforts shall be for medical research into, education about and support for persons within our service area.

Our History

 

The Imperial Court System is comprised of organizations from over 70 cities across the United States, Canada and Mexico, each organization is Sovereign but working toward the same goals, donating our time and efforts to improve the lives of those in need. The United Court of the Lone Star Empire Inc., along with 6 other Sovereign Courts in Texas comprise the United Courts of Texas. Though Sovereign in right, the focus is the same, working together to improve the lives of those in need throughout the Lone Star State.

 

A Historical Timeline

September 1978 - Formed and First Meeting of the Imperial Court of the Lone Star Empire presided over by HMIM Michael Caringi, Emperor IV after Norton, of San Francisco

October 1978 - First fundraising event of the Imperial Court of the Lone Star Empire held at the Texas Territory Bar

December 1978 - the Imperial Court of San Francisco states that they will honor Dallas as an Imperial Court once all necessary papers were filed and authorized Emperor Michael Caringi to place the crowns on the heads of the first ones chosen as Emperor and Empress of Dallas

July 1979 - First Coronation of the Imperial Court of the Lone Star Empire

July 1979 - First African-American Empress of Dallas, Cindy Birdsong, is elected

July 1982 - First Coronation of the United Sovereign Council of Texas

July 1984 - Coronation for the Imperial Court of the Lone Star Empire is moved from July to November

November 1986 - The Imperial Court of the Lone Star Empire and the United Sovereign Council of Texas re-unite to form the United Court of the Lone Star Empire

November 1986 - First Coronation of the United Court of the Lone Star Empire

November 1986 - First fundraising event of the United Court of the Lone Star Empire is held at Buddies bar

July 1987 - United Court of the Lone Star Empire receives word that its application to become a non-profit corporation has been approved by the State of Texas; making it the first incorporated Court in the State of Texas

November 1988 - The United Court of the Lone Star Empire, Inc. receives word that it has been granted tax-exempt status by the IRS as a 501(c)(4) corporation

November 1988 - First Lesbian Emperor of Dallas, Linda May, is elected

October 1994 - First Hispanic Emperor of Dallas, Albert Hernandez, is elected

November 2002 - First Heterosexual Female Empress of Dallas, Pam Steele, is elected

November 2003 - First Hispanic Empress, Veronica Morgan, of Dallas is elected

August 2006 - The United Court of the Lone Star Empire, Inc. receives word from the IRS that its application for change to 501(c)(3) status has been accepted

November 2006 - First Lesbian Empress of Dallas, Julie Walker, is elected

 

January 2007 - Julie Walker is named Heir Apparent to Empress Nicole the Great, QM1 of the Americas

 

November 2007 - The first pair of Hispanic monarchs are elected, JR Duran and Devon DeVasquez

 

October 2009 - First Trans-Gendered Empress of Dallas, Miss Audrey Dumae Germany, is elected

 

January 2009 - Donna Dumae is named Heir Apparent to Empress Nicole the Great, QM1 of the Americas

September 2010 - UCLSE adopts a 7 member Board of Directors effective January 1, 2011

 

December 2010 - Devon DeVasquez is the first member from Parliament to be named an Heir Apparent to Empress Nicole the Great, QM1 of the Americas


October 2012 - First gay married couple elected as Emperor and Empress, Larry Harrell and Messy Panocha

 

October 2013 - First non-monarch is elected as an officer to the Board of Directors, Louis Kenmar, Secretary

 

January 2013 - UCLSE adopts an 11 member Board of Directors

 

October 2014 - UCLSE elects the first non-monarch President of the Board of Directors, Mickey Hightower

 

December 2014 - UCLSE adopts a 9 member Board of Directors

 

December 2014 - Ricky Matlock is named Heir Apparent to Queen Mother of the Americas, Empress Nicole the Great
